Enfusion, Inc. (ENFN)
NYSE: ENFN · Real-Time Price · USD
11.16
+0.03 (0.27%)
Jan 31, 2025, 4:00 PM EST - Market closed

Enfusion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019
Period Ending
Jan '25 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19
Market Capitalization
1,4398566671,373--
Market Cap Growth
15.71%28.36%-51.42%---
Enterprise Value
1,4128646461,632--
Last Close Price
11.169.709.6720.94--
PE Ratio
527.60149.73----
Forward PE
42.0543.5269.0785.47--
PS Ratio
5.184.914.4412.29--
PB Ratio
14.8911.056.4514.09--
P/TBV Ratio
12.6515.9610.2624.84--
P/FCF Ratio
52.0640.4365.59---
P/OCF Ratio
45.5533.4147.12---
PEG Ratio
0.510.510.510.64--
EV/Sales Ratio
7.244.954.2914.61--
EV/EBITDA Ratio
76.2246.60----
EV/EBIT Ratio
126.0372.29----
EV/FCF Ratio
51.0840.7863.47---
Debt / Equity Ratio
0.220.200.07--1.45-2.16
Debt / EBITDA Ratio
0.760.59--12.961.88
Debt / FCF Ratio
0.760.730.69--3.51
Asset Turnover
1.651.501.311.542.55-
Quick Ratio
3.413.145.0910.192.451.84
Current Ratio
3.623.445.5711.062.712.00
Return on Equity (ROE)
5.48%10.23%-13.20%-1920.21%--
Return on Assets (ROA)
5.92%6.42%-6.51%-237.53%12.19%-
Return on Capital (ROIC)
6.76%7.34%-7.19%-269.50%16.73%-
Earnings Yield
0.19%0.70%-1.15%-11.53%--
FCF Yield
1.92%2.47%1.52%-0.47%--
Payout Ratio
0.00%---113.57%87.00%
Buyback Yield / Dilution
-7.71%-51.57%-2.83%-173025.83%--
Total Shareholder Return
-7.71%-51.57%-2.83%-173025.83%--
Source: S&P Capital IQ. Standard template. Financial Sources.